1. Remove bolts (1) that hold the elbow in position on the oil pump. Remove bolt (2) and lock that fastens the suction bell to the oil pan plate.
The oil pump idler gear (5) can fall off the pump when the pump is removed. To prevent injury, always hold gear on the pump when the pump is removed.
2. Bend the two tabs on the locks on the left hand side of the engine. Remove the four bolts (3) and (4) that fasten the oil pump to the cylinder block. Remove the oil pump and suction bell as a unit. The weight of the unit is 16 kg (35 lb.). Remove idler gear (5) from the oil pump.Install Oil Pump
1. Install idler gear (2) on the oil pump. Put the oil pump (1) in position on the cylinder block. Be sure idler gear (2) is engaged with the crankshaft gear and the tabs on locks on the left hand mounting bolts are not next to the oil pan gasket surface when the bolts are tightened. 2. Install bolts (3) that fasten the gasket and elbow to the oil pump.3. Install the lock and bolt (4) that hold the suction bell to the oil pan plate.End By:a. install oil panDisassemble Oil Pump
Start By:a. remove oil pump 1. Remove idler gear (2). Remove bearing from gear with tooling (B).2. Remove suction bell (1).3. Remove the bolt and the washer from the oil pump drive gear. 4. Remove the drive gear from the shaft with tooling (A).5. Remove the key from the pump shaft.6. Remove bolts (3) from the pump body. 7. Remove body (8), two gears (7), keys and spacer (4) from the pump.8. Remove two shafts (5) and the gears.9. Remove bolts (6), the cover and the pressure relief valve from the body. 10. Remove the bearings from the oil pump body assembly and the scavenge pump body assembly with tooling (B).Assemble Oil Pump
1. Install the bearings in the scavenge pump body assembly with tooling (A) and a press as follows:a. Put bearings (9) in position on the inside of the scavenge pump body assembly with the chamfer on the bearing toward the outside of the pump body. Install the bearing until it is 1.52 mm (.060 in.) below the inside machined surface of the scavenge pump body assembly. Make sure the joints in the bearings are at an angle of 30° 15° from the center line through the bores in the scavenge pump body and toward the outlet passage of the pump. The outlet passage has a cavity between the bearing bores. 2. Install the bearings in oil pump body assembly with tooling (A) and a press as follows:a. Put bearings (10) in position on the inside of the oil pump body assembly with the chamfer on the bearings toward the outside of the pump body. Install the bearings until they are even with the outside of the pump body. Make sure the joints in the bearings are at an angle of 30° 15° from the centerline through the bearing bores and toward the outlet passage of the pump. The outlet passage has a cavity between the bearing bores.3. Check the condition of the relief valve. Check the condition and specifications for all the parts of the oil pump before it is assembled. See OIL PUMP in SPECIFICATIONS.4. Put clean engine oil on all the parts of the oil pump. 5. Install pressure relief valve (11), cover (12) and bolt (6) in the oil pump body assembly. 6. Install gears and shafts (5) in the oil pump body assembly.7. Install spacer (4) and the two keys in shafts (5). 8. Install two gears and scavenge pump body assembly (13).9. Install key (14), drive gear (2), the washer and bolt (15). Tighten the bolt to a torque of 43 7 N m (32 5 lb.ft.).10. Install the bearing in the idler gear with tooling (A) and a press until it is even with the outside surface of the gear.11. Install the idler gear and suction bell.
The oil pump must turn freely by hand after it is assembled.
End By:a. install oil pump
